; Date: Tue, 23 Nov 2004 10:33:18 -0500 ; From: Jim Muth ; Subject: [Fractint] FOTD 23-11-04 (The Evil Masque [7]) ; Id: <1.5.4.16.20041123103449.0da750de@pop.mindspring.com> ; --------- ; ; FOTD -- November 23, 2004 (Rating 7) ; ; Fractal visionaries and enthusiasts: ; ; Today's image was created by the next formula in line, the ; 'marksmandelpwr' formula, which was proposed by Mark Peterson. ; This formula is set apart from the other mandelbrot formulas by ; the function coefficient C that is initialized for each pixel to ; Z^(Z-1). It draws quite a variety of fractals, some of which ; are very interesting. ; ; With only a limited time to become familiar with the formula, I ; obviously have missed most of what it can do, but even in the ; short time I worked with it, I found today's 7-rated image. ; ; I named the image "The Evil Masque".
